How to Obtain your CQ Network Approval

There are two levels of approval within the CQ Network system:
Standard (CQS) Approval or Advanced (CQA) Approval.

Standard Approval, requires that the following be met and maintained within your account:

  • Achieve a minimum CQ Network Evaluation score of 60%.
  • Have current Comprehensive General Liability (CGL) and Automotive Insurance.
  • Have current HSE Performance data (Stats) and WCB/WSIB/EMR Performance data.

Account must be in good standing with no outstanding payment.

Advanced Approval, requires that the following be met and maintained within your account:

  • Achieve a minimum CQ Network Evaluation score of 85%
  • There cannot be a zero (0) score on questions within the Health, Safety and Environmental Management section and Training, Skills Development and Recordkeeping section (Questions 2.1 – 3.3)
  • Have current Comprehensive General Liability (CGL) and Automotive Insurance.
  • Have current HSE Performance data (Stats) and WCB/WSIB/EMR Performance data.
  • WCB/WSIB/EMR rate is in a discount position
  • A Certificate of Recognition (COR) is obtained, current and uploaded into your account. (There is a 30-day expiry grace period)
  • Account must be in good standing with no outstanding payment.
